Demi Leigh was killed outside her home by a dangours drive who should not have been on the road anyway as he had been banned and was untaxed and uninsured!
All he got was community service. This wee girls life was lost and he never had to pay! Causing death by dangours driving carries a maximum sentence of 14 years. However with current guidlines its very hard to prove so it is hardly ever used. Drivers usually get away with a fine or community service at most even if they killl innocent people! This is not enough!!!
 
We want the law to change so that if a driver kills someone and its their faul they should be disqualifed from driving for ever!
The law should be changed to make it easier to prove causing death by dangourise driving!
The maximum sentence for death by dangerouse driving should be life!
